• Green Rubber Process Oil Market, Global Outlook and Forecast 2025-2032
    The global Green Rubber Process Oil Market is gaining significant traction as industries increasingly prioritize sustainable manufacturing solutions. Valued at US$1.8 billion in 2024, the market is projected to expand at a robust 6.7% CAGR, reaching US$2.5 billion by 2032. This growth reflects the rubber industry's transition toward environmentally friendly processing aids that reduce pol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bon (PAH) emissions without compromising performance characteristics.

    Market Overview & Regional Analysis
    Asia-Pacific commands over 65% of global demand, with China's tire manufacturing sector driving substantial consumption. The region's growth is further amplified by India's burgeoning automotive industry and Southeast Asia's expanding rubber product manufacturing base. Meanwhile, Europe demonstrates the fastest adoption rate due to stringent REACH regulations, with Germany and France leading in bio-based oil integration.

    North America maintains steady growth through technological innovations in sustainable tire production, while Latin America shows emerging potential through Brazil's natural rubber production capabilities. The Middle East & Africa market, though smaller, benefits from strategic partnerships between local rubber producers and European chemical manufacturers.

    Key Market Drivers and Opportunities
    The market's expansion is propelled by three key factors: regulatory shifts toward low-PAH formulations, the automotive industry's sustainability commitments, and advancements in bio-based process oils. Tire manufacturing alone accounts for 72% of total demand, with non-tire rubber products making up the remaining 28%.

    Notable opportunities include the development of next-generation oils from non-food biomass and the integration of recycled rubber processing technologies. The EU's forthcoming tire labeling regulations and North America's infrastructure investments present additional growth avenues. Emerging applications in high-performance elastomers and specialty rubber compounds are creating niche market segments with premium pricing potential.

    Challenges & Restraints
    While the market shows strong growth prospects, it faces several hurdles. The price premium of 15-20% over conventional process oils continues to hinder adoption in price-sensitive markets. Technical limitations in extreme-temperature applications and inconsistent feedstock availability for bio-based variants create additional barriers.

    Supply chain complexities have intensified due to geopolitical tensions affecting crude oil derivatives. Furthermore, the lack of standardized global regulations creates compliance challenges for multinational manufacturers. Smaller rubber processors in developing economies particularly struggle with the capital requirements for transitioning to green process technologies.
